We continue to grow and address the needs of our community through quality and patient-centered care.# Our Gastroenterology Office is seeking an experienced Surgical Scheduler to coordinate and carry out all surgical scheduling functions and to support the office assistants by providing customer service and performing general administrative tasks as needed.# Overview of responsibilities include but are not limited to: Coordinate and manage surgical scheduling, ensuring accurate patient demographics, procedure bookings, and timely communication of schedule changes. Obtain insurance prior authorizations, referrals, and approvals required for surgeries, procedures, testing, and pre-operative care. Collaborate with surgeons, operating room staff, primary care providers, and other departments to ensure efficient patient care and resource availability. Prepare, distribute, and maintain surgical documentation, including admission forms, consent forms, History # Physical reports, and pre-operative records. Educate patients on surgical procedures, testing requirements, pre-operative instructions, and follow-up care. Schedule diagnostic testing, laboratory work, cardiac evaluations, procedures, and post-operative or follow-up appointments. Provide patient check-in and check-out support, including appointment scheduling, recall management, and registration assistance as needed. Accurately enter outpatient orders, maintain electronic scheduling systems, scan patient records, and manage medical documentation. Deliver excellent customer service by answering phones, responding to patient inquiries, managing voicemail messages, and directing calls appropriately.
